转载

苹果副总裁说:关闭后台进程并不会改善iPhone续航

苹果副总裁说:关闭后台进程并不会改善iPhone续航

  身边许多拿 iPhone 做主力机的朋友,常常会向我吐槽 6S 糟糕的续航能力。重度使用一整天,需要拿充电宝从 0 到 100% 灌满三次,差不多相当于 1700mAh*3。

  脆弱的续航也潜移默化地影响着 iPhone 用户的使用习惯。在各种「省电秘籍」的文章轰炸之下,越来越多的人们相信手动关闭 App 进程可以有效提升 iPhone 续航,并乐此不疲。

  然而,事实并非如此。

  在苹果公司软件高级副总裁 Craig Federighi 回复给用户的一封邮件中,他坦然承认关闭 iOS 系统中的后台进程对提升续航无济于事。

苹果副总裁说:关闭后台进程并不会改善iPhone续航

  究其原因,这是由 iOS 系统的运行原理和内存管理机制决定的。与 Android 不同,在 iOS 中手动关闭 App 后台仅相当于清除了一部分已经「冻结」在运行内存(RAM)中的进程,而这些「当前非活跃进程」对电池电量的消耗几乎可以忽略不计。这与 Android 宽松的后台权限和自启机制有非常大的区别。在安卓设备中清理进程的做法并不能给 iPone 带来多少好处,反而是一种对时间和精力的浪费。

  真正对续航有显著影响的是,GPS 定位、蓝牙、NFC 和后台音乐播放等功能。好在 iOS 对应用权限的管理非常严格,不规矩的 App 开发者会收到警告甚至惩罚。

  尽管如此,iOS 从 1.0 迭代到今天的 9.2 版本,仍然允许 iPhone 用户在任务管理界面滑动关闭进程是为什么呢?简单说来,其实是一种安慰剂效应,通过向用户赋权达到省电或流畅的效果,与 iOS 系统相机对焦时的程序抖动有异曲同工之妙。

  目前来看,苹果似乎并没有撤销「滑动关闭」这项交互操作的意图,需要知道的是,关不关进程对续航真的没多大意义。

正文到此结束
Loading...